Responsibilities include but are not limited to:

  • System Administration: Perform routine system administration tasks, including installation, configuration, and maintenance of Red Hat Enterprise Linux (RHEL) and Microsoft Windows systems.

  • Monitoring and Maintenance: Monitor system performance, and ensure system availability and reliability. Perform regular security monitoring to identify any possible intrusions.

  • User Support: Provide technical support to end-users, and troubleshoot hardware and software issues related to RHEL systems.

  • Automation and Scripting: Develop and maintain scripts to automate system administration tasks. Use tools such as Bash, Python, or Ansible for task automation.

  • Patch Management: Apply patches, updates, and security fixes to ensure systems are secure and up-to-date.

  • Documentation: Maintain documentation of system configurations, procedures, and troubleshooting steps. Ensure all changes are documented and comply with organizational policies.

  • Backup and Recovery: Implement and manage backup and recovery procedures to ensure data integrity and availability.

  • Compliance: Ensure systems comply with organizational and industry standards for security and performance.
